Ventricular fibrillation (VF) is a life-threatening cardiac arrhythmia characterized by chaotic electrical activity in the ventricles, the heart's lower chambers.
During VF, the heart loses its ability to pump blood effectively, leading to a lack of blood flow to vital organs.
Without immediate intervention, such as defibrillation to restore a normal heart rhythm, the condition can rapidly progress to cardiac arrest and cause death within minutes.
Unlike tachycardia (A) or bradycardia (D), which involve abnormal heart rates, VF is a more severe and critical situation with disorganized electrical signals and ineffective pumping, requiring urgent medical attention.

The correct option would be the epithelial tissue.
Epithelial tissues are made up of tightly arranged cells and primarily functions as protective covers for organs and outer surfaces. Usually, a side of the component cells in epithelial tissue are in contact with organs which they are covering through a non-cellular basement membrane and the other side of the cells are free.
The non-cellular basement membrane that connects the cells in epithelial tissues to organs and surfaces is secreted jointly by the epithelial and connective tissues and usually made up of protein and carbohydrate.

During inspiration, the air enters through the nares in the nose. From here, it goes up passing through the vestibule, the nasal cavity, and the choanae to start descending through the pharynx. The pharynx has three parts: the nasopharynx, which is in contact with the nose; the oropharynx that is in contact with the mouth; and the laryngopharynx, which is in contact with the larynx and esophagus. Between the oropharynx and laryngopharynx is the epiglottis, this is cartilage that prevents food from going to the lungs when we swallow food. After passing through the pharynx, the air flows through the larynx. From here, the air goes to the trachea, the bronchi, which enters the lungs giving the bronchioles, and these divide giving the alveolus, which is the place where the exchange of Oxygen and Carbon dioxide occurs.

Facilitated diffusion occurs when large molecules that are unable to pass through a membrane on their own make use of channel proteins to move from one side of the membrane to the other. Facilitated diffusion can occur when a liquid on one side of a membrane has a higher osmotic pressure than a liquid on the other side of the membrane, but it isn’t a required feature of facilitated diffusion. Similarly, facilitated diffusion can occur when there’s a large membrane potential present, but it isn’t a required feature of facilitated diffusion. Facilitated diffusion doesn’t require the use of energy, so the presence of ATP is irrelevant to facilitated diffusion occurring.

DNA is transcribed to messenger RNA (mRNA), and the mRNA is translated to proteins on the ribosomes. A sequence of three nucleotides on an mRNA molecule is called a codon. As you can see in the table, most codons specify a particular amino acid to be added to the growing protein chain. In addition, one codon (shown in blue) codes for the amino acid methionine and functions as a "start" signal. Three codons (shown in red) do not code for amino acids, but instead function as "stop" signals.

Photosynthesis is a unique process carried out by the cells of autotrophic organisms. It is the process whereby they synthesize their own food in form of sugars (glucose) in the presence of sunlight. Ideally, the photosynthetic process makes use of carbon dioxide (C02) and water (H20) in the presence of light energy (from sun) to produce glucose sugar (C6H12O6) and oxygen (02). The general photosynthetic equation is as follows:
6CO2 + 6H20 + light → C6H12O6 + 6O2
However, the process is not as simple as portrayed as it involves many separate steps that collectively forms the photosynthetic product (glucose). Photosynthesis occurs in two major stages namely: light stage and light independent stage, which in turn consists of series of reactions that forms the products.

Eutrophication refers to a situation in which the aquatic environment becomes excessively enriched with nutrients. This leads to algal blooms in aquatic habitats such as lakes. These nutrients come from Fertilisers used in farming, which find their way into water bodies through run-off thereby increasing nutrient levels.
Excess nutrients causes phytoplankton to grow and reproduce at an alarming rate resulting in algal blooms. This bloom disrupts the balance in the ecosystem leading to many problems.
The algae may end up using all the oxygen in the water, causing oxygen shortage for aquatic life. Some of the algae may die, their decay may lead to further oxygen depletion. As oxygen is depleted, aquatic organisms may also begin to die.

All living things on Earth are arranged in an hierarchical level of organization. The order in descending way is as follows:
1. Biosphere- Biosphere refers to the part of the Earth that constitutes all living organisms in interaction with their environment. It is the total of all ecosystems on Earth.
2. Ecosystem: Ecosystem refers to a group of living organisms i.e plant, animal and microbes interacting with each other and their abiotic environment e.g water, air etc. An ecosystem comprises of several communities.
3. Community- Community refers to a group of organisms interacting with each other at a particular time and habitat. A community is made up of two or more populations.
4. Population- Population refers to a group of organisms of the same species living together in the same habitat and capable of interbreeding.
5. Species- A species is a group of organisms usually with the same appearance and capable of producing fertile offsprings by interbreeding.
6. Organism- An organism is an individual living thing i.e. plant, animal, microbe. An organism is made up of several organ systems that work together to make it whole.
7. Organ system- Organ system refers to a group of organs working in an interconnected manner to perform certain functions in an organism.
8. Organ- An organ is a structure in an organism that performs a specific function.
9. Tissue- A tissue is a group of cells working together for the same purpose.
10. Cell- A cell is the basic and fundamental unit of life, which is the building block of all living organisms.
11. Organelles- An organelle is a specialized structure in a cell that performs specific functions. e.g. nucleus, mitochondria etc.
12. Molecule- A molecule is the smallest unit of a chemical compound responsible for the chemical identity of that compound. A molecule is made up of two or more atoms chemically bonded together.
13. Atom- An atom is smallest indivisible unit of mattter that partakes in chemical reactions. Atom is considered the smallest unit of matter.
